Description
Tucked against the Cascades corridor of the Mountain Loop Highway near Barlow Pass, this Mt. Baker-Snoqualmie National Forest pullout sits amid dense old-growth forest with a river running close enough to swim. Pull-offs on both sides of the road lead to informal tent sites nestled among the trees — the terrain is uneven roadside but workable for smaller rigs up to about 25 feet. A fire ring with a carved-log bench adds a rough-hewn charm, and no cell signal means genuine quiet; satellite messaging is the only link out.
